Compounding Pharmacies: Tailoring Medication to Individual Needs
Compounding pharmacies stand as a beacon of individualized care in the realm of medication. These specialized pharmacies possess the unique ability to formulate medications tailored precisely to each patient's specific requirements. Whether it's adjusting dosage forms for comfort, incorporating preferred ingredients, or addressing allergies, compounding pharmacies offer a flexible approach to medication management.
- Ultimately, compounding pharmacies empower healthcare providers and patients to achieve optimal therapeutic outcomes through personalized medication solutions.
Grasping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ients (APIs)
Active pharmaceutical ingredients also known as APIs are the fundamental components of medications. They are the elements responsible for producing a therapeutic effect within the body. APIs affect biological processes to relieve symptoms or address underlying medical conditions.
The development and manufacturing of APIs is a meticulous process that involves extensive research, testing, and regulatory oversight.
Drug manufacturers invest heavily in API development to ensure the safety, efficacy, and quality of medications.
A thorough understanding of APIs is crucial for pharmacists as well as individuals who take medications regularly. It allows informed decision-making about treatment options and encourages patient well-being.

Prescription vs. Over-the-Counter: Key Differences Explained
Navigating the world of medications can be complex, particularly when distinguishing between prescription and over-the-counter (OTC) options. Although both aim to relieve ailments, key differences exist in their accessibility, severity of conditions they address, and potential side effects. Prescription medications require a physician's evaluation, signifying a greater level of medical involvement. Alternatively, OTC medications are readily available without a prescription, intended for mild ailments. Understanding these distinctions is crucial for making informed decisions about your care.
- Seek advice from a healthcare professional for any serious health concerns.
- Always review the label instructions and potential side effects of any medication before use.
- Store medications safely out of reach of children.
